Being new to the forum, let me just say to be careful of getting too many Shopping Card Trick cards especially from Comenity who can at times be weird if you mix store and bankcards lol. A key word you used was you dont need the card. So you are using it for utilization purposes. Be careful of getting cards that you dont need just to get. But since you did get it, dont tax yourself crazy and make a huge purchase just for cli. You either will get them or you wont so just buy things you might need for your home , small and just pif and be responsible with it. Many times just using your card is enough. Take care of it and it will grow... even if you don't want it to. I bought a few small things here and there... Initial SL was 3500 or so. Paid off my $500 I owed on it back in February and now, 7 months later it's at $15,600 as of this morning. Don't think I need this much but they see you buy and pay, they'll increase it for you. Really helps with credit utilization but don't think I'll ever buy $15,000 worth of something from Wayfair at one time.
Congrats on the approval and like others have said it will grow quickly. I've had this card less than a year and it went from the same SL of $500 to $5800 in that span. The average increase is about $1500 for me about every other month or so. It is my only Commenity card so I don't really have too much fear is asking for increases regulary.
